CORDELE – The fifth Annual Wink Taylor Classic Scholarship Golf Tournament, sponsored by the Dooly County Chamber of Commerce and the BIG PIG JIG®, is scheduled for Oct. 9 at the Lake Blackshear Resort Golf Club in Cordele. The 2015 tournament will mark a celebration of five years of community support, honor, spirit, competition, friendships, and charity under the name of the late Wink Taylor of Americus, Vienna and Cordele. This event has been a staple for many years as a preamble to the BIG PIG JIG® event.
The field of golfers is made up of some of the most influential members of the local business community, as well as dignitaries from the surrounding area. Local golf enthusiasts also embrace the tournament as well. The casual atmosphere, a fun and relaxed awards ceremony, and players of varying abilities have kept many individuals and businesses returning year after year. Proceeds from the Wink Taylor Classic benefit the Dooly County Chamber scholarship fund.
Last year’s scholarship recipient, Massey Evans, of Byromville recently said, “The scholarship helped me pay for my books mainly. I feel the scholarship is a great idea for helping and rewarding students for their academic achievements.”
Rhonda Lamb Heath, President/CEO of the Chamber said “The Dooly County Chamber/BIG PIG JIG® has sponsored academic scholarships for over 15 years now and we look forward to continuing to provide these important scholarships for many years to come”
